No Gun Found After Arrest for Threats

Arrest information from the Napa Police Department does not indicate a conviction.

An elderly Napa man was arrested Tuesday afternoon following a report that he was threatening to get a gun, according to a shift activity log released by the City of Napa Police Department:

On 10-11-11 at about 1428 hours, employees of , 350 Soscol Ave, called police to advise there was a male on the property making threats about a gun. 

Officers arrived and contacted Harry Schoonmaker, 69 yrs, Napa Resident.

The victim advised the suspect made threats to retrieve a gun from his vehicle. 

It was unknown why the suspect came to the property as he had no lawful business there and was not known to the employees.

He was placed under arrest for criminal threats and booked. 

No gun was found in Schoonmaker’s vehicle, police said.
